Patient Reunification / Mass Casualty Event Responder - Mental Health - Relief
MindWise Innovations / Trauma Center
In this vital role, the Patient Reunification Responder will provide telephonic support to individuals calling into a hotline setup to search for loved ones in the hospital system, in the event of a Mass Casualty Incident, in the Commonwealth of Massachusetts.
The Patient Reunification Responder will:
- participate in response to Mass Casualty Incidents, when hotline is set up is by the State
- attend and participate in annual trainings and drills, in the absence of Mass Casualty Events
- work as part of clinical team under the direction of an incident commander
- perform the function of incident commander, as identified for that function by and under the supervision of the Director, Assistant Director or designee
- report on services provided and the results of interventions to the incident commander, both verbally, and, as requested, in writing
- assist individuals and families impacted by trauma to obtain other services and supports as follow-up to the intervention provided
- maintain confidentiality of protected health information and privileged consumer information in conformity with state and federal laws and regulations
- communicate with consumers, colleagues and collateral staff in a respectful manner

Required Skills
- Participation in basic training on disaster response/ critical incident de-briefing management required
- Experience working in a compassionate manner with individuals who have experienced highly stressful events/ situations
- Expertise or cultural humility in working with diverse cultural, racial, gender groups preferred
- Bilingual language capability strongly preferred
Required Experience
- Bachelors Degree required (Human Service or Mental Health related field preferred)
- Masters Degree in Psychology, Social Work or Clinical, Human Services related field preferred (such as MSW, Counseling, Psychology)
- Independent license preferred
